The Preliminary Billing Analysis (PBA) collects activity for billing. You may request an immediate PBA by Client, Estimate, Media, Vendor, Client/Vendor or Client/Product. Activity is determined to be billable based on the settings for the client/product/media/estimate in Profiles Definition. Depending on the settings in FSI Collection, the PBA may also collect data for the Financial Status Inquiry. Those agencies using the Billing Calendar have automatic routines that periodically collect billing for specified clients.
While the PBA is running, the activity being collected is unavailable. When the PBA completes, the results are available on the PBA Report that is sent to the billing output queue defined in Profiles Definition for the company/office. Activity from previous PBAs continues to be included on the PBA Report until bills are released or canceled for that activity through Live/Draft Bills.
To schedule the collection of activity:
Use Monthly Billing Schedule to schedule a client for inclusion on the overnight PBA for one or more specific dates.
Use Billing Request to add specific estimates to the next overnight PBA.
Use Billing Request to request a PBA immediately for specific clients, media, estimates, vendors or Client/Vendor or Client/Product rather than waiting for the next scheduled overnight PBA.
You may request draft bills to be produced for your review, instead of needing the to take the extra step of ordering them in Live/Draft Bills.
While a PBA is in progress:
No one may release live or draft bills for any client that is included in the PBA.
For a client request, no one can request the client or any of that client's estimates for an immediate PBA until the first PBA is completed.
For a media request, no additional requests may be submitted by the sign-on company/office that made the request until the first PBA is completed.
For an estimate request, the PBA only collects the latest activity for that estimate, but it will also show any unreleased activity that was previously collected for the estimate.
Note: You may only request an Immediate PBA by media if the company/office profile in Profiles Definition is set to Allow Media Level Immediate PBA.
